General Objective:

Upon completion of the sports nutrition module, the learner will be able to comprehend and apply fundamental nutritional principles to enhance athletic performance and overall well-being.

Specific Objectives :

  1. To recognize the significance of macronutrients (carbohydrates, proteins, fats) and their roles in energy production, growth, and repair in athletes.
  2. To analyze individual requirements for caloric intake and macronutrients based on the type, intensity, and duration of physical activity, as well as individual characteristics.
  3. To design balanced and appropriate nutritional plans for various training phases and athletic competitions.
  4. To understand the role of micronutrients (vitamins and minerals) in vital bodily functions and athletic performance.
  5. To elucidate the importance of adequate hydration and the impact of dehydration on athletic performance and health.
  6. To differentiate between common types of dietary supplements and evaluate their effectiveness and potential risks.
  7. To implement optimal nutritional strategies before, during, and after exercise or competition to improve performance and recovery.
  8. To recognize the influence of specific health conditions (such as food allergies or chronic diseases) on sports nutrition.
  9. To critically evaluate nutritional information related to sports and be able to distinguish between myths and scientific facts.
